Avaz Yuldoshev

DUSHANBE, August 3, 2011, Asia-Plus  — President Emomali Rahmon’s visit to the northern Sughd province has started from the Yaghnob area in the Anzob jamoat, Ayni district, the presidential press service reports.

The president familiarized himself with living conditions of residents of Yaghnob and answered their numerous questions about power supply, medical aid, etc.

The head of state ordered relevant government bodies to develop the project for construction of a 26-kilometer road that would connect Yaghnob and the Anzob Jamoat, the source said.

The president then visited the city of Panjakent, where he attended a ceremony of opening of indoor pool.

In Panjakent district, Rahmon visited the Khalifa Hasan jamoat, where he got acquainted with activities of local farming unit Mehnatobod.  President’s meeting with Panjakent administrators took place in the Mehnatobod field camp.

In Panjakent, the president also attended a ceremony of an official opening of a new gold mining enterprise that has capacity of processing some 2,000 tons of ore per day, the source added.
